Somerset: Josh Davey, Ben Green and Kasey Aldridge to leave club

Advertisements

“Josh, Ben and Kasey have played an important role in our success over recent years and all three have secured winner’s medals with the club,” Somerset director of cricket Adam Hurry told the club’s website, external.

“All three players were offered contract extensions, however, they have taken the decision to seek enhanced playing opportunities elsewhere and we must respect that decision.”

Davey, 34, moved to Somerset from Middlesex for the 2014 season and has made 159 appearances for the club across all formats, scoring 1,906 runs and taking 317 wickets.

Green, 27, has taken 99 wickets and scored 770 runs for Somerset in T20 cricket.

Aldridge, 24, signed his first contract with Somerset aged 17 and has made 32 first-class appearances.
